How to Make Windows 10 Faster?

Windows 10 is the most used version of all the windows, It has been positively reviewed the most since 2015 when it was released. But heavy use and aging hardware inevitably slows it down and make it sluggish.
Here are some steps that can help you keep Windows 10 performing to its maximum capacity.

1.Adjust visual effects

The Windows 10 animations look visually attractive, but those effects use most of the computing power. But of course, here’s an option to save your power by a simple step.
Type performance in the taskbar search box and select Adjust the appearance and performance of Windows.
A dialogue box will open, On the Visual Effects tab of the same, select Adjust for best performance and click Apply. Restart your PC to make the change take effect.

2. Turn on fast startup

Another way to make certain that you save your power and Windows 10 boots up faster is enabling a feature called fast startup which will load the hibernation file into memory and saves time.
The setting is usually enabled by default. To check, go to the Control Panel and click Power Options. Next click Choose what the power buttons do and then Change settings currently unavailable.
At last, Tick the Turn On fast start up the checkbox under Shut-down settings.

3. Make updates more efficient

Make sure that Windows 10 and programs are up to date, this can improve its performance by eliminating bugs. Automatic updates should be on by default. To check everything is up-to-date, click Start then Settings, Update & security, Windows Update and Check for updates. To turn automatic updates on, select Advanced options, and then under Choose how updates are installed, click Automatic (recommended).

Also, To make updates run when you want and don’t need the additional power, search for Windows Update settings, click on the relevant icon, and under Update settings select Change active hours.
You can then choose the times at which you want updates to be installed automatically.

4. Run disk cleanup

Disk Cleanup can be used to save up drive space which can help Windows run better by removing unnecessary files.
Click Start and search for Disk clean-up and click it when it appears. To delete temporary files, under Files to delete, select the file types you want to remove and select OK.

To free up extra space by deleting system files, select Clean up system files, and again select the file types you want to remove and select OK.

5. Disable unnecessary startup programs

If you have an excessive number of programs set up to start automatically and run in the background, it will slow down the startup of Windows 10.
To disable those programs you don’t need, press Ctrl + Alt + Delete, and then select Task Manager. Select More details in the lower-left corner of the Task Manager dialogue box and select the Startup tab.
Select Disable for any program you don’t need. Restart your PC to make the changes take effect. This will significantly make your Windows 10 Faster than before.
